Bull plans major privacy and Payjoin update

Francis Pouliot, CEO at Bull Bitcoin.com, announced that Bull is set for significant privacy advancements during what he described as 'privacy summer.'

Upcoming developments include a total Payjoin refactor, described as state of the art for collaborative spends, and enhanced UTXO management. Pouliot also hinted at multiple new privacy features under development, noting that two are especially substantial.

Pouliot previously noted that the Bull team is focused on helping people worldwide become sovereign Bitcoin users, with a focus on global Bitcoin adoption as detailed here. In a separate discussion, he highlighted the importance of transparency in Spark wallets, describing how custodial aspects depend on wallet exit options here. These remarks follow Bull Bitcoin’s ongoing product enhancements and emphasis on user control.
